of course, you can do multiple regression. y=x1+x2+x1*x2. You first need to test the significance of the interaction term, if not significant, you then can build a reduced model with only main effects. Afterwards, model diagnostic procedure is important to check the goodness fit of your model, and then .....,
you can follow this procedure to analyze your data. your problem is easily to be solved.
